WHEREAS, A life made rich through meaningful service drew to | ||
a close with the passing of Anne Newberry Bergman of Weatherford on | ||
November 4, 2020, at the age of 95; and | ||
WHEREAS, The former Anne Newberry was born in Weatherford on | ||
March 12, 1925, to William and Mary Newberry; she received a | ||
bachelor's degree in accounting from Trinity University in 1946, | ||
and the following year, she married Robert Bergman, whom she had met | ||
on a blind date; the couple shared a rewarding marriage that spanned | ||
seven decades, and they took great pride in their three children, | ||
Elizabeth, John, and William, and in their 11 grandchildren and 4 | ||
great-grandchildren; and | ||
WHEREAS, Passionate about politics, Mrs. Bergman was a | ||
delegate to the Republican Party state convention beginning in | ||
1952, and she contributed her time and energy to a number of | ||
gubernatorial, congressional, and presidential campaigns; from | ||
1976 to 1977, she served as president of the Texas Federation of | ||
Republican Women; engaged in her local community as well, she held a | ||
city council seat and was a founding member of the Friends of the | ||
Weatherford Public Library; she attended All Saints' Anglican | ||
Church, and she played a key role in establishing the church's | ||
orphanage in Mexico; and | ||
WHEREAS, Above all else, Mrs. Bergman cherished time spent | ||
with her family, and she especially enjoyed traveling and sailing; | ||
she and her husband were also valued members of the Weatherford Wine | ||
and Food Society; and | ||
WHEREAS, While the passing of Anne Bergman brings great | ||
sadness to her loved ones, she leaves behind a legacy that will long | ||
be treasured by all those who held her dear; now, therefore, be it | ||
